Job Description Your Role: - Plan, manage, and execute releases across all environments - from development to production. - Identify technical and functional interdependencies between various tracks. - Coordinate with all development pods and stakeholders across programs. - Review application code, documentation, and perform pre/post deployment tasks. - Define release process for new data engineering applications. - Change management communication to all required stakeholders. - Execute release packages, step-by-step deployment guides, and command line instructions on production environment. - Support project timelines, clearly setting expectations, and realigning expectations internally as priorities change. - Develop a sound understanding of client’s needs: data conversion and migration requirements, environment management and build processes, deployment planning and execution, solution designs, systems integrations, technical architectures, and infrastructure architectures. Your Profile: - Execute deployment scripts and step-by-step instructions in test and production environments. - Comfortable with Command Line Interfaces. - Understanding of CI/CD, Git branching, packaging and DevOps pipelines. - Working knowledge of data warehousing and reporting technologies: Azure, Databricks, Unity Catalog, Python, Spark, PySpark, Airflow, MicroStrategy, Tableau. #LI-DC10 #LI-Remote Capgemini is a global business and technology transformation partner, helping organizations to accelerate their dual transition to a digital and sustainable world, while creating tangible impact for enterprises and society.
